Maybe it has been this > way for awhile (long while?) and I didn't notice it. > g.copy is a general tool which creates a copy of the data. Perhaps you are interested in r.clip which is a raster tool and is driven by the computational region as expected. r.clip clips according to the current computation region (preserves original raster alignment by default). https://grass.osgeo.org/grass-stable/manuals/addons/r.clip.html > > I think, but I'm not 100% sure, that has always been the case. Here is g.copy documentation from v6.4 it does not mention anything about region. It seems to go back to US Army CERL. https://github.com/OSGeo/grass-legacy/blob/2734c86fd5cb976b4a94b04a2cdc75b4613f6a77/general/manage/cmd/g.copy.html#L6 > In any case, it seems to be the logical behavior, otherwise it wouldn't be > a true copy? > Are the different expectations coming from differences between raster tools and general tools? With r.copy (as opposed to g.copy), you could perhaps argue for respecting the computational region, but I think the "true copy" expectation would still be strong.
